MySQL 默认的数据库权限设置密码是指在安装 MySQL 时设置的 root 用户的密码。这个密码用于登录 MySQL 数据库管理系统并执行管理操作。以下是关于 MySQL 默认数据库权限设置密码的一些基础概念和相关信息:
基础概念
- MySQL 安装:在安装 MySQL 时,系统会提示设置一个 root 用户的密码。这个密码是访问和管理 MySQL 数据库的关键。
- 权限管理:MySQL 使用基于角色的访问控制(RBAC)来管理用户权限。root 用户通常拥有最高权限,可以访问和修改所有数据库和表。
相关优势
- 安全性:通过设置强密码,可以防止未经授权的访问和潜在的安全威胁。
- 灵活性:可以根据需要为不同用户分配不同的权限,实现细粒度的访问控制。
类型
- 默认密码:在安装 MySQL 时设置的初始密码。
- 自定义密码:用户可以根据自己的需求更改默认密码。
应用场景
- 数据库管理:管理员使用 root 用户登录 MySQL,执行数据库创建、删除、备份等操作。
- 应用集成:应用程序通过配置文件或环境变量获取数据库连接信息,包括用户名和密码。
常见问题及解决方法
问题:为什么无法登录 MySQL?
原因:
- 密码错误。
- 用户名错误。
- 网络问题。
- MySQL 服务未启动。
解决方法:
- 确认密码是否正确。
- 确认用户名是否为
root
。 - 检查网络连接是否正常。
- 确认 MySQL 服务是否已启动。可以通过命令行工具如
systemctl status mysql
或 service mysql status
检查服务状态。
问题:如何更改默认密码?
解决方法:
- 停止 MySQL 服务。
- 以不检查权限的方式启动 MySQL:
- 以不检查权限的方式启动 MySQL:
- 登录 MySQL:
- 登录 MySQL:
- 更改密码:
- 更改密码:
- 重启 MySQL 服务。
参考链接
请注意,以上信息仅供参考,实际操作时请根据具体情况进行调整。